Output 25f7ac4dbbdc66e8e9691c59d57f817cedadbf4bead4d980ca83e182dc8ffca2:0

value
20412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8efbf219bda0a16ef652b6bb3cfba09a5efc50c4 OP_EQUAL
address
3Ej3hH61WHJJdf2AJjrN5UqT7vQFGnNG9M
transaction
25f7ac4dbbdc66e8e9691c59d57f817cedadbf4bead4d980ca83e182dc8ffca2
confirmations
202845
spent
true